← Back to context

Comment by tartoran

1 day ago

Backwards compatibility. Apparently there are still some people stuck on IE11. It's nice that jQuery still supports those users and the products that they are still running.

This is the part that I find the strangest:

> We also dropped support for other very old browsers, including Edge Legacy, iOS versions earlier than the last 3, Firefox versions earlier than the last 2 (aside from Firefox ESR), and Android Browser.

Safari from iOS 16, released in 2022, is more modern in every conceivable way than MSIE 11. I'd also bet there are more people stuck with iOS 16- than those who can only use IE 11, except maybe at companies with horrid IT departments, in which case I kind of see this as enabling them to continue to suck.

I'd vote to rip the bandaid off. MSIE is dead tech, deader than some of the other browsers they're deprecating. Let it fade into ignomony as soon as possible.

  • “Support” here probably means “we’re testing jQuery for compatibility on those web browsers” - likely Safari from iOS 16 still runs this version of jQuery just fine. However, running automated test suites or support bugfixing for those clients is a lot harder than spinning up some Microsoft-provided VM with IE11 on it.

  • There are a lot of intranet web applications that require IE, and IE is still in support by Microsoft. Even on Windows 11 Edge still has IE Mode for that reason. IPhones stuck on older iOS version by definition aren’t supported by Apple anymore.

    • Use those browsers for the internal undead apps, but a modern browser for the Internet.

      Those phones are still supported. The most recent iOS 16 update was in September 2025.

  • It’s rarely a horrid IT department but some special or legacy software without modern replacement

    • But is this horrid legacy software really going to be pulling in a new major version of jQuery?

  • > Safari from iOS 16, released in 2022, is more modern in every conceivable way than MSIE 11.

    There are likely millions if not tens of millions of computers still running MSIE11. There are likely to be no devices running iOS 16

    • > There are likely to be no devices running iOS 16

      My iPhone X is stuck on iOS 16 with no way to upgrade.

      However, the phone is still working well. Despite being in daily use for 8 years it still has 81% battery capacity, has never been dropped, has a great OLED screen, can record 4K@60 video. It is far more responsive than a brand new 2025 $200 Android phone from e.g. Xiaomi. It still gets security patches from Apple. The only real shortcoming compared to a modern iPhone is the low light camera performance. That and some app developers don't support iOS 16 anymore, so e.g. I can't use the ChatGPT app and have to use it via the browser, but the Gemini app works fine.

Who is still stuck on IE 11---and why?

  • There are some really retrograde government and bigcorps, running ten year old infrastructure. And if that is your customer-base? You do it. Plus I worked on a consumer launch site for something you might remember, and we got the late requirement for IE7 support, because that's what the executives in Japan had. No customers cared, but yeah it worked in IE7.

  • One of my clients in the past had, as of 2020, noticeable traffic from IE8, 9 and IE11. When I say noticeable I mean 10%+ out of million users.

    It followed the 8-17 monday-friday pattern.

    Essentially it was people at their work machines (posts, banks, etc) running corporate computers where modern browsers were not installed.

    We had a computer for manually testing every release on IE8 and 9.

    If somebody is looking for our products from those computers, we aren't gonna lose them.

    But as far as I know, that client dropped support for IE8 and IE9 in 2024 with IE11 planned to be dropped this year.

  • I think anything still using ActiveX like stuff or "native" things. Sure, it should all be dead and gone, but some might not be and there is no path forward with any of that AFAIK.

  • Surely by this point someone has written a 0-day for MSIE 11 which gets root and silently installs an Internet Explorer skinned Chromium. If not, someone should get onto that. —Signed, everyone